Borussia Dortmund are eyeing Fiorentina striker Nikola Kalinic.
After resisting pressure to sell the Croatia international to Tianjin Quanjian in January, the Viola are again fielding offers ahead of the summer market.
Florence media sources say Napoli and AC Milan are both keen to keep Kalinic in Italy.
However, BVB are also in contact as they see the 29 year-old as a potential replacement for wantaway star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ang.
Having rejected €50 million from Tianjin Quanjian over the New Year, Fiorentina are now likely to sell Kalinic for €20-25 million this summer.
